Transanal Decompression Tube Versus Stent for Acute Malignant Left-sided Colonic and Rectal Obstruction

Brief Summary
The purpose of this study is to compare the clinical outcomes of transanal decompression tube as a bridge to surgery with stent as a bridge to surgery for acute malignant left-sided colonic and rectal obstruction.

Outcome Measures
Primary Outcomes (1)
Creation of stoma
Creation of stoma include temporary and definitive stoma.
From the date of randomization until the date of first documented creation of stoma, assessed up to 24 months
Secondary Outcomes (3)
Transanal decompression tube/stent-related complications
From the date of randomization until the date of first documented transanal decompression tube/stent-related complication, assessed up to 7 days
Surgery-related complications
From the date of randomization until the date of first documented surgery-related complication, assessed up to 24 months
Overall survival
From the date of randomization until the date of death from any cause, assessed up to 24 months
Study Arms (2)
Transanal decompression tube
OTHERPatients undergo placement of the transanal decompression tube as a bridge to surgery
Stent
OTHERPatients undergo placement of the stent as a bridge to surgery

Eligibility Criteria
You may qualify if:
- definite diagnosis of left-side colonic or rectal obstruction;
- symptomatic colonic obstruction for less than 1 week;
- colonic obstruction caused by a histologically proven malignant colonic tumor
You may not qualify if:
- suspected benign colonic or rectal obstruction;
- right-side colonic obstruction;
- patients with signs of peritonitis;
- dysfunction of blood coagulation, active bleeding, active infection, and significant cardiac or pulmonary disease;
- patients who do not want to undergo surgery.
